Analysing Policy
Discover a transformative perspective on public policy with Analysing Policy by Carol Lee Bacchi. Published in 2009, this insightful book spans 319 pages and presents a unique methodology for evaluating policy. Bacchi introduces a compelling framework of six critical questions designed to explore how 'problems' are represented within policies. Readers are encouraged to apply these questions to their own policy proposals, fostering a deeper understanding of the intricacies of policy-making.
This analytical approach is essential for grasping the mechanisms of governance and recognizing how the practice of policy-making shapes our identities as individuals.
